Heat Transfer Characteristics of a Rotating Two-Phase Thermosyphon.
Abstract
A rotating two-phase thermosyphon fitted with a copper condenser section was tested at 700, 1400 and 2800 RPM using water, ethanol and freon 113 as working fluids. Both experimental and theoretical heat transfer rates were determined. Agreement between theory and experiment was good at low rotational speeds and improved as the rotational speed increased.
